1.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is Kinematics?
Back
The branch of physics that describes the motion of objects without considering the forces that cause the motion.
2.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is a Force?
Back
A push or pull that can change the motion of an object.
3.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is Displacement?
Back
The shortest distance from the initial to the final position of an object, including direction.
4.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is Velocity?
Back
The speed of an object in a specific direction.
5.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is Acceleration?
Back
The rate at which an object's velocity changes over time.
6.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is the formula for calculating acceleration?
Back
Acceleration = (Final Velocity - Initial Velocity) / Time.
7.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What does a displacement-time graph show?
Back
It shows how the position of an object changes over time.
